What is the Level 3 Foundation Diploma in Engineering?

The Level 3 Foundation Diploma in Engineering is a vocational qualification designed for students aged 16 and above. It serves as an introduction to the engineering sector, providing a broad understanding of core engineering principles and practices. The course is ideal for those who wish to pursue further education or enter the workforce with a solid foundation in engineering.

Key Features of the Course

  • Comprehensive Curriculum: Covers essential topics such as mathematics, physics, materials science, and engineering design.
  • Hands-On Learning: Emphasizes practical skills through workshops, lab sessions, and real-world projects.
  • Industry-Relevant Skills: Prepares students for apprenticeships, higher education, or entry-level engineering roles.
  • Flexible Pathways: Offers opportunities to specialize in areas like mechanical, electrical, or civil engineering.
